Thomas Hodgkin Symposium


This event is in the past. This is an archive page for reference.

Presentations on the life and work of Thomas Hodgkin (1799-1866) who discovered Hodgkin's Disease.

He was also a campaigner against slavery and the evening will conclude with a talk by the Revd James Buxton, King's College Chaplain at Guy's, on the struggle against contemporary forms of slavery.

The event, one of several marking the bicentenary of the abolition of the slave trade, is in the Harris Lecture Theatre at the Hodgkin Building at Guy's Hospital.
